diff --git a/.github/workflows/copilot-setup-steps.yml b/.github/workflows/copilot-setup-steps.yml index b97fbe0869..4579ac2a38 100644 --- a/.github/workflows/copilot-setup-steps.yml +++ b/.github/workflows/copilot-setup-steps.yml @@ -8,7 +8,7 @@ jobs: contents: read steps: - name: Checkout code - uses: actions/checkout@v6 + uses: actions/checkout@v7 with: submodules: recursive diff --git a/.github/workflows/general-ci.yml b/.github/workflows/general-ci.yml index 3c9de2d0f2..8d49f2a70f 100644 --- a/.github/workflows/general-ci.yml +++ b/.github/workflows/general-ci.yml @@ -22,7 +22,7 @@ jobs: simplify: [0,1,autoopt] steps: - - uses: actions/checkout@v6 + - uses: actions/checkout@v7 with: submodules: 'recursive' - name: Set up Python ${{ matrix.python-version }} diff --git a/.github/workflows/gpu-ci.yml b/.github/workflows/gpu-ci.yml index 70df74dd94..5f8ac948ef 100644 --- a/.github/workflows/gpu-ci.yml +++ b/.github/workflows/gpu-ci.yml @@ -23,7 +23,7 @@ jobs: if: "!contains(github.event.pull_request.labels.*.name, 'no-ci')" runs-on: [self-hosted, gpu] steps: - - uses: actions/checkout@v6 + - uses: actions/checkout@v7 with: submodules: 'recursive' - name: Install dependencies diff --git a/.github/workflows/heterogeneous-ci.yml b/.github/workflows/heterogeneous-ci.yml index d95667e127..82907599d7 100644 --- a/.github/workflows/heterogeneous-ci.yml +++ b/.github/workflows/heterogeneous-ci.yml @@ -23,7 +23,7 @@ jobs: if: "!contains(github.event.pull_request.labels.*.name, 'no-ci')" runs-on: [self-hosted, linux] steps: - - uses: actions/checkout@v6 + - uses: actions/checkout@v7 with: submodules: 'recursive' - name: Install dependencies diff --git a/.github/workflows/linting.yml b/.github/workflows/linting.yml index f1b63e8d1c..cc50b78241 100644 --- a/.github/workflows/linting.yml +++ b/.github/workflows/linting.yml @@ -14,7 +14,7 @@ jobs: steps: - name: Check repository - uses: actions/checkout@v6 + uses: actions/checkout@v7 - name: Setup Python 3.10 uses: actions/setup-python@v6 diff --git a/.github/workflows/ml-ci.yml b/.github/workflows/ml-ci.yml index f2436c96d6..c32a2121e7 100644 --- a/.github/workflows/ml-ci.yml +++ b/.github/workflows/ml-ci.yml @@ -22,7 +22,7 @@ jobs: simplify: [0,1,autoopt] steps: - - uses: actions/checkout@v6 + - uses: actions/checkout@v7 with: submodules: 'recursive' - name: Set up Python ${{ matrix.python-version }} diff --git a/.github/workflows/pyFV3-ci.yml b/.github/workflows/pyFV3-ci.yml index 48384765a2..95e5d5de49 100644 --- a/.github/workflows/pyFV3-ci.yml +++ b/.github/workflows/pyFV3-ci.yml @@ -25,7 +25,7 @@ jobs: matrix: ${{ steps.set-matrix.outputs.matrix }} steps: - name: Checkout to repository - uses: actions/checkout@v6 + uses: actions/checkout@v7 - name: Set matrix data id: set-matrix run: echo "matrix={\"include\":$(jq -c . < .github/workflows/pyFV3-regression-matrix.json)}" >> $GITHUB_OUTPUT @@ -40,13 +40,13 @@ jobs: steps: - name: Checkout pyFV3 - uses: actions/checkout@v6 + uses: actions/checkout@v7 with: repository: 'NOAA-GFDL/pyFV3' path: 'pyFV3' - name: Checkout dace - uses: actions/checkout@v6 + uses: actions/checkout@v7 with: path: 'dace' submodules: 'recursive'